Hey guys,

I bought bblite a few days ago just to try it out, but I haven't been able to enjoy it as it doesn't work with my iPhone 3G. I always get a popup error that says 'Could not activate cellular data network: You are not subscribed to a cellular data service'.

I've changed the APN which was originally www.iphone-vodafone.net.nz to www.vodafone.net.nz and it still doesn't work. I've rung the iPhone service twice and they can't seem to find out what the problem is. I tried my simcard using another phone and it worked just fine. I went in to the vodafone store, and the guy there tried his simcard on my iPhone, and it was working fine. But when it's my sim, it doesn't work. I even got a new sim today.

Can anyone suggest anything? Your help would be much appreciated. :)

The iPhone apn routes back to the www.Vodafone.net.nz apn have you tried a restore on your iphone? Just confirming your Sim works in another phone using the www.Vodafone.net.nz apn
